Nesolon village council joins Bronykivska AH

On 19 June, the deputies of the Bronyky village council unanimously supported the decision to join the Nesolon village council.

“Last year, in August, the Nesolon village council deputies sent documents to their neighbours, but the Bronykivska AH did not provide its consent to accession. There was a shortage in several deputies’ votes. Today the AH deputies have unanimously supported this decision,” told Serhii Romanovych, adviser on decentralisation from the Zhytomyr LGDC.

Further, it should be a process of registering all necessary documents, and additional elections should be carried out on the territory of the Nesolon village council.

The specialists from the Zhytomyr Local Government Development Centre of the U-LEAD with Europe Programme conducted the informative and explanatory work on implementing the decentralisation reform in the Zhytomyr Oblast and benefits of communities' accession to already formed AHs.

The consultation meeting with the deputies of the Bronykivska AH in the Novohrad-Volynskyi Rayon on accession of the Nesolon village council took place in May.
